Another beer I believe I had at Foam Brewing in October 2019.

Pours an amber color. Barely a hint of that rose/pink color scheme. 1/3" white head. Had the aroma of a lightly dry rose petal, dry grape skin, coriander kind of impression.

Taste hit the salinity note that was missing from the nose. More of that rose bark grape skin dehydrated rose petal and hibiscus note. Tad maltier than most goses, but not problematic. Impressive part was how there was a hint of caramel and lactose and yet a dry almost raspberry like mouthfeel at the same time. Deft hand. The 'sourness' was on the lower end, maybe a 3 on a 10pt scale for gose. Commercial tug job about strawberry notes seem inflated.

Kind of mixed feelings about this. Is it good? Yes. I do wonder if I would like it even more if there was more of a salt/sour aspect to it, but it does a good job with incorporating the rose aspect to it.

Pours rose gold in color with 1/4 inch head. Taste is rose wine and salt. Light bodied, moderate carbonation, and salty. Makes for a very wine like beer. Another Two Roads winner. They really know how to make goses.
